A Graduate Certificate in Molecular Visualization for Molecular Genetics offers specialized training in advanced visualization techniques crucial for understanding complex biological systems. This program equips students with the skills to interpret and communicate molecular data effectively, bridging the gap between experimental data and insightful biological conclusions.
Learning outcomes typically include proficiency in using various software packages for molecular modeling, protein structure analysis (including homology modeling and molecular dynamics simulations), and the creation of high-quality scientific visualizations. Students will develop expertise in data analysis and interpretation, essential for translating complex datasets into meaningful visualizations. The curriculum also often incorporates training in scientific communication to effectively disseminate research findings.
The duration of such a certificate program is usually between 9 and 18 months, depending on the institution and the credit requirements. Specific software training might include popular packages like PyMOL, VMD, Chimera, and UCSF ChimeraX, which are widely utilized in the field for 3D molecular modeling and visualization.
